The Charm of Basque Cheesecake

Basque Cheesecake has taken the dessert world by storm with its distinctive jiggly texture and rich flavor profile. Originating from the Basque region of Spain, this cheesecake is characterized by its burnt top, which adds depth and an irresistible caramelized flavor. Unlike traditional cheesecakes that often rely heavily on a crust, this version forgoes it, allowing the focus to remain on the creamy goodness of the filling. The result is a dessert that is both pleasing to the eye and tantalizing to the palate.

What sets this cheesecake apart from its American counterpart is the simplicity of its ingredients and the ease of preparation. You won't need to worry about water baths or complex crust techniques. Instead, you can whip up the batter in mere minutes, pour it into a loaf pan, and let the oven do the rest. This effortless approach makes it an excellent choice for both novice bakers and seasoned chefs alike.

Tips for the Best Cheesecake

To achieve the perfect consistency, ensure your cream cheese is fully softened at room temperature before mixing. This step is crucial for a smooth batter and helps avoid any lumps that could compromise the silky texture of your cheesecake. Be vigilant while mixing; over-beating can incorporate too much air, making your cheesecake puff up during baking and then sink as it cools.

Another helpful tip is to check for doneness by looking for a slightly wobbly center when removing the cheesecake from the oven. The residual heat will continue to cook the cheesecake as it cools, ensuring a perfectly set dessert without being overbaked. Lastly, give it sufficient chilling time in the refrigerator—this enhances the flavor and texture, making each slice even more enjoyable.

Ingredients

For the Cheesecake

  • 2 cups c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our

Mix all the ingredients together until smooth and creamy.

Steps

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

Prepare the Batter

In a mixing bowl, beat the cream cheese and sugar until smooth. Add in the eggs one at a time, followed by the heavy cream, vanilla extract, and flour.

Bake

Pour the batter into a lined loaf pan and bake for 40 minutes or until the top is nicely browned.

Cool and Serve

Let the cheesecake cool at room temperature, then chill in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ours before serving.

Serve chilled and enjoy your decadent cheesecake!

Storing Your Basque Cheesecake

If you have any leftover cheesecake, storing it properly is key to maintaining its creamy texture and flavor. Cover the cheesecake with plastic wrap or transfer it to an airtight container before placing it in the refrigerator. It will stay fresh for about 3 to 5 days in the fridge. For longer storage, consider freezing individual slices. Wrap each slice tightly in plastic wrap followed by aluminum foil for extra protection, and it can last for up to 2 months in the freezer.

When you're ready to enjoy a frozen slice, simply transfer it to the refrigerator to thaw overnight. Avoid using a microwave for defrosting as it can alter the texture of the cheesecake. Enjoy it chilled, and rediscover the delightful flavors that made it a hit!

Pairing Suggestions

This Basque cheesecake pairs beautifully with a variety of beverages. For a simple yet delightful pairing, serve it alongside a rich coffee or espresso. The bitterness of coffee complements the sweetness of the cheesecake, leading to a balanced dessert experience. If you prefer a non-caffeinated option, consider serving it with a glass of chilled herbal tea or sparkling water, which can cleanse the palate in between bites.

For wine lovers, a glass of dessert wine, such as a late-harvest Riesling or a sweet Moscato, enhances the flavors of the cheesecake while adding a touch of sophistication to your dessert table. Feel free to explore different pairing options, as this versatile cheesecake can adapt and shine with various flavors.
